    Only the people who are stupid enough to believe the rhetoric that coaches and GM's throw out there would think that it was a terrible pick. You really think anyone would have given them a first round pick for a quarterback that made openly available from the day after the draft? The Eagles played their cards right. They made everyone believe that Bradford was their guy and they were going to sit this rookie for at least a year before they put him out there. If the Vikings knew the Eagles were going to dump Bradford ASAP then they would have offered a 2nd round pick and gotten him anyway. But by making him the starter they added value to him, they made it seem like they couldn't put their fan base through trading their opening day QB without getting value in return, which they did in getting a first and a fourth round pick. The Eagles had NO intention of keeping Bradford past this year, they just wanted to increase the trade value, whether it happened now or next off season.
    Also there was whispers among beat writers in Philly that Bradford's shoulder was wearing down. Could just be a rumor but the Vikings will find out soon enough.
    Eagles made a steal in this trade. Plus they get to start the franchise guy from day one. A total win-win.
